Try cleaning the atty in very hot water . All you need realy . If there is juice holding it that will free it up . It should stick out about a fingernail width and because of the spring inside , compress when you apply pressure . It has a floating pin and a coiled spring that touched the coil head . If it does not compress after cleaning it could be the spring may have gotten too hot and needs replaceing but that is very hard to do , probably just stuck/stiff pin .
